收藏
回答

使用小程序转多端应用不能后台录音?

recorderManager.onError((res) => {

      console.log('录音错误', res);

      this.setData({ isRecording: false });

      

      // 根据错误类型给出不同提示

      let errorMsg = '录音失败';

      if (res.errMsg && res.errMsg.includes('auth')) {

        errorMsg = '需要录音权限';

        // 显示权限引导

        wx.showModal({

          title: '录音权限',

          content: '请允许使用麦克风权限,或在设置中手动开启',

          confirmText: '去设置',

          cancelText: '取消',

          success: (modalRes) => {

            if (modalRes.confirm) {

              wx.openSetting();

            }

          }

        });

        return;

      }

      

      wx.showToast({

        title: errorMsg,

        icon: 'error',

        duration: 2000

      });

    });


使用转多端应用转成 IOS 的 APP,在页面中点击录音可以正常录音与播放,但是在录音途中切换 APP,或者将当前 APP 退至后台,录音中断,是不支持后台录音吗?

回答关注问题邀请回答
收藏

1 个回答

  • 智能回答 智能回答 本次回答由AI生成
    2025-09-01
    有用
登录 后发表内容